#16cf54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16cf54 is composed of 8.6% red, 81.2%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 140.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 44.9%. #16cf54 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ffa8 with #009f00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#16cf54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16cf54 has RGB values of R:22, G:207,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 1494868.

Shades and Tints of #16cf54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c05 is the darkest color, while #f9f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#16cf54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7771 is the less saturated color, while #04e14e is the most saturated one.
